The January 2026 housing stats for Brevard County show a "calm and steady" start to the year. While single-family home inventory remains tight with a slight dip in median prices to $375,000, the townhouse and condo market is seeing a massive 20.2% surge in pending sales. Buying a home is an exciting journey, but it requires careful planning to ensure success. Start by assessing your finances and setting a realistic budget. Get pre-approved for a mortgage to strengthen your position, and research neighborhoods that align with your lifestyle. Partnering with a skilled real estate agent is the most crucial step, as they guide you through the process, negotiate on your behalf, and handle key details.
